Cell Cycle-Dependent Localization of Voltage-Dependent Calcium Channels and the Mitotic Apparatus in a Neuroendocrine Cell Line(AtT-20)
Figure 4
Sites of calcium transients during mitosis. Calcium transients correspond with sites of CaV1 immunofluorescence in AtT-20 Cells during mitosis. Simultaneous imaging of (a) Fluo4 (M) intracellular calcium transients and (b) cell morphology by DIC in AtT-20 cells during cytokinesis. Regions: 1=midbody; 2, 3=spindle mid-zone; 4=nuclear region of interphase cell; 5=background (media only). (c) Plot of fluorescence units for each region over time (sec). Regions of enhanced calcium transients correspond to midbody (1) and spindle mid-zone (2, 3). Break in X-axis marks time of acquisition following loading of Fluo-4.
